        Razkel, old favorites include , the Inn at Phillips Mill, Hamilton Grill Room, The Washington Crossing Inn among many others which you would find by looking at the Philadelphia Board. Although a bit of a drive from Philly, many consider this area to be in the general SMSA of Philadelphia which is why there are many listings there. You will need reservations at the Grill room. Be sure to stop for a drink before across the driveway at the Boathouse. Phillips Mill and Washington Crossing are at opposite ends of the main road thru New Hope, Hamilton is across the river in Lambertville.
